OpenAI Safety Research Lead Joins Anthropic
Andrea Vallone, who led OpenAI's research on how AI models should respond to users showing signs of mental health distress, has left the company to join Anthropic's alignment team. During her three years at OpenAI, Vallone built the model policy research team, worked on deploying GPT-4 and GPT-5, and helped develop safety techniques such as rule‑based rewards. At Anthropic, she will continue her work under Jan Leike, focusing on aligning Claude's behavior in novel contexts. OpenAI Introduces Mid‑Response Interrupt Feature for ChatGPT
OpenAI has added a new capability that lets users interrupt ChatGPT while it is generating a response. By clicking an “Update” button, users can add new context or corrections without restarting the query, allowing the model to adjust its answer on the fly. The feature is aimed at heavy‑use scenarios such as GPT‑5 Pro and Deep Research, where long‑running queries can be costly and time‑consuming.
